def rename_landsat(dirpath:str):
"""
rename landsat 8/9 images and save them in concise folder name.
parameter
---------
dirpath: str path to the directory which contains the images.
dirpath should be ended up with forward slash '/' to avoid,
FileNotFoundError: [WinError 2].
LXSS_LLLL_PPPRRR_YYYYMMDD_yyyymmdd_CC_TX
Where:
L = Landsat
X = Sensor (“C”=OLI/TIRS combined, “O”=OLI-only, “T”=TIRS-only, “E”=ETM+, “T”=“TM, “M”=MSS)
SS = Satellite (”07”=Landsat 7, “08”=Landsat 8)
LLL = Processing correction level (L1TP/L1GT/L1GS)
PPP = WRS path
RRR = WRS row
YYYYMMDD = Acquisition year, month, day
yyyymmdd - Processing year, month, day
CC = Collection number (01, 02, …)
TX = Collection category (“RT”=Real-Time, “T1”=Tier 1, “T2”=Tier 2)
references
https://www.usgs.gov/faqs/what-naming-convention-landsat-collections-level-1-scenes
https://www.usgs.gov/faqs/what-naming-convention-landsat-collection-2-level-1-and-level-2-scenes
"""
for path in Path(dirpath).glob('*.tar'): ### rglob
print('image_path_name:\n',path, '\n', 'image_name\n',path.name)
s = path.name
LXSS = s.split("_")[0]
LLLL = s.split("_")[1]
Acquisition_year = s.split("_")[3]
Processing_year = s.split("_")[4]
name = LXSS,'_'+'_',LLLL+'_', Acquisition_year
str = functools.reduce(operator.add, (name))
os.rename(dirpath+s, dirpath+str+'.tar')
for item in os.listdir(dirpath):
if item.endswith('.tar'):
name_1 = LXSS, LLLL, Acquisition_year, Processing_year
data.append(name_1)
df = pd.DataFrame(data, columns=['LXSS',
'LLLL',
'Acquisition_year',
'Processing_year'])
print('\nBrief information table of landsat images\n', df)
os.makedirs(dirpath +'Landsat_dataframes', exist_ok=True)
df.to_csv(dirpath+'Landsat_dataframes/landsat9.csv', encoding='utf-8')
